Basic Transcript Questions [#permalink]
03 Jan 2007, 09:24
1. Is it okay if I include all of my transcripts together in one Fed-Ex package as long as they are signed and official?
2. Will schools be confused if they receive transcripts before I submit an application? Should I include a brief letter explaining why they are receiving these, or is it common sense? I'm paranoid that they will look up my name, not see anything, and simply throw them away.
